**Purpose**:
To co-ordinate all administrative functions in order to assist in the smooth running of the school and to maintain accurate accounts and systems of financial control as regards delegated financial duties. As part of your duties, you are expected to work in conjunction with the line manager.

1. To be responsible for assisting in managing the school office.

2. To assist in the maintenance of the various school computerised databases of pupil and staff information.

3. To provide administrative support to the SLT as appropriate.

4. Financial Administration.

5. Administration support for EHCp

**Principle Accountabilities**

**1. Responsibility for assisting in managing the school office, including**:

- Co-ordinates and supervise the work of office staff and to ensure the school office is organised efficiently.
- Liaising with line manager relating to work to be undertaken by the office
- Assisting with monitoring the induction of any new member of the office staff.
- Deputising for the line manager in relation to the above duties, in her/his absence.
- General word processing.
- Provide administrative support in organising safety procedures, including fire drills.
- Oversee the general administration of school dinners.
- Sign in visitors and obtain and check relevant vetting documents

**2. Assisting in the maintenance of the various school computerised databases of pupil and staff information, including**:

- Maintaining and updating the school’s database of pupil records with all key information including medical information, attendance and family details.
- Update School’s electronic sign in system (Inventry) and produce reports
- Liaising with school medical lead and external professionals as directed
- Completing termly DfE pupil census
- Producing electronic reports from MIS for SLT research and monitoring

**3. To provide administrative support to the School Leadership Team as appropriate, including**:

- Assisting the SLT in all aspects of their roles, including contacting parents and pupils where necessary
- Attending meetings as and when required and taking notes / minutes.
- In liaison with the SLT, maintaining a confidential filing system.

**4. Financial Administration.**
To be responsible for accounting procedures in the school as regards to
- School journey accounts and Enterprise funds
- School accounts and banking of dinner monies
- To be responsible for petty cash including banking
- To keep a record of expenditures and process payments

**5. Administration support for EHCp**
- Organise and review schedule for EHCp Reviews meetings and make final modifications having consulted with SLT, teaching staff and LA EHCp coordinators
- Liaise with the LA EHCp co-ordinators out of borough LA co-ordinators
- Contact LA and ensure that Highshore has an electronic & paper copy of all EHCp plans for every pupil
- Create electronic folder containing all EHCp documentation for each pupil
- Contact parents and arrange for them to attend EHCp meetings
- Contact outside organisations and request reports and inform them of EHCp meeting dates (Transition team, social care, CAMHs, OT)
- Liaise with all stakeholders to ensure all sections of EHCp documents are updated for pupils they work with within the allotted
- Liaise with school staff involved with transition in order that they attend EHCp meeting
